Output 3916abebdec9eb25c917e64566a63927dc5491f44fd453e348853977e46e4c25:1

value
3074995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afec89b8c503b8ae8540b921321fd72801020ee1 OP_EQUAL
address
3HjDY4Uc3roVXKMLJSVVxHUWkyxgA9X7MX
transaction
3916abebdec9eb25c917e64566a63927dc5491f44fd453e348853977e46e4c25
confirmations
463321
spent
true